The station embraces simplicity with essential ticketing services. While open ticket office hours are limited to the early morning stretch from 06:10 to 12: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, ticket machines are available all day for self-service. If you're a fan of booking online, fret not—you can easily collect your online purchases at the ticket machine, although be mindful that accessible ticket machines are unavailable here. Despite this, a smartcard validator is present at the station for those traveling on local networks.
For those requiring assistance, help points offer a direct line to staff during the same hours as the ticket office. Though staff can't physically aid in boarding, they can provide assistance over the phone. Bear in mind, accessible features are somewhat limited, yet the station does accommodate step-free access to platforms via lifts and footbridges—an often overlooked but essential feature for passengers with mobility considerations. Heated waiting rooms can be found on Platforms 1 and 2/3, and a sheltered seating area is available on Platform 4.
While Kidsgrove Station may not boast a plethora of amenities, it does include basic conveniences such as toilets within the booking hall, though these are not accessible for those with disabilities. If you're in the mood for a bite to eat or looking to grab a quick coffee, you might need to plan ahead as the station offers no in-house refreshment options or shops. However, being a key point on the East Midlands Railway network, it does ensure a Safe environment—CCTV is present not only in the station but also over the bicycle storage areas.

Minster station is equipped with ticket machines that cater to online ticket collections, making the preparation for your journey seamless. While the station does not have a ticket office, the presence of accessible ticket machines, conveniently positioned by the entrance to platform 2, makes it easy for everyone, including those with accessibility needs, to secure their train tickets. Though there is no luggage storage, waiting rooms, or refreshment options, the station still manages to provide essential services. You'll find customer help points available to ensure your questions are answered, and a helpline is at hand for any additional support.
Regarding accessibility, Minster station has partial step-free access under category B1. You can expect step-free travel towards London via a railway foot crossing. While not staffed, help from Southeastern's mobile assistance team can be arranged in advance for those needing additional support. Although there are no dedicated station staff, assistance is available directly on the trains, promising smooth boarding and disembarking.
